Adjective: mushy (mushier,mushiest) mú-shee
- Having the consistency of mush
"The mushy peas were a perfect side dish for the fish and chips"
- [informal] Effusively or insincerely emotional
"mushy effusiveness";
- bathetic, drippy [informal], hokey [N. Amer, informal], maudlin, mawkish, kitschy, schmaltzy [informal], schmalzy [informal], sentimental, sappy [informal], soppy [Brit, informal], soupy [informal], slushy [informal], corny [informal], cutesy [informal], gooey [informal], weepy [informal], cheesy [informal]
